About the Role:

We are hiring a Strategic Finance Manager, Product (EPD) to partner with Engineering and Product to drive unit economics, infrastructure efficiency, and margin expansion across Vercel’s consumption-based platform.

This role spans cloud infrastucture & token spend, as well as emerging AI workloads (inference, gateways, and compute-intensive services). You will define how we measure and optimize the cost and profitability of every request, workload, and AI interaction on the platform.

What You Will Do:

Infrastructure & AI COGS Ownership

Own financial visibility into compute, bandwidth, storage, and AI-related costs (e.g., inference, GPU/accelerated workloads)

Translate product and infrastructure usage (requests, execution time, tokens, etc.) into clear cost drivers

Partner with EPD to drive cost-efficient architecture and scaling decisions

Cost Visibility & Accountability

Build self-service cost tooling for Product and Engineering (cost per request, per workload, per AI query)

Enable teams to own and optimize their infrastructure footprint

Standardize cost attribution across products and multi-tenant systems

Efficiency & Margin Expansion

Lead infrastructure and AI efficiency initiatives (compute optimization, caching, vendor strategy)

Define north star metrics (e.g., cost per request, cost per AI call, cost per GB)

Embed cost efficiency into roadmaps and product decisions

Cost Allocation & Financial Rigor

Develop scalable cost allocation frameworks across products, customers, and workloads

Improve gross margin visibility, including AI product margins

Support auditability and IPO readiness

Cross-Cutting Workstreams

Unit Economics

Define product-level unit economics across Vercel’s product suite

Connect usage (requests, compute, tokens, etc) to revenue and COGS

COGS / Gross Margin Forecasting

Build driver-based models linking usage, revenue, and infrastructure costs

Forecast COGS across core platform and AI products for both PLG & SLG segments

Model margin impact of scale and efficiency improvements

Pricing & Packaging

Partner on usage-based and AI pricing models

Evaluate tradeoffs between growth, adoption, and margin

Ensure pricing is reflected in forecasts and unit economics

About You:

5-8+ years in Strategic Finance, FP&A, IB, or Consulting

Experience with consumption-based or cloud infrastructure businesses

Strong modeling skills; experience with driver-based forecasting

Ability to partner with technical teams and translate usage → financial insight

SQL / data tooling experience strongly preferred

The San Francisco, CA base pay range for this role is $180,000-$220,000. Actual salary will be based on job-related skills, experience, and location. Compensation outside of San Francisco may be adjusted based on employee location. The total compensation package may include benefits, equity-based compensation, and eligibility for a company bonus or variable pay program depending on the role.
